3D Printing in Dental Surgery
To boost the area of dental surgery, you can discover the subtopic of 3D printing in dental surgery. This innovative innovation has the prospective to transform the way dental surgeons run and deal with people. Below are four crucial methods which 3D printing is shaping the field:
- ** Customized Surgical Guides **: 3D printing allows for the creation of highly precise and patient-specific surgical overviews, enhancing the accuracy and effectiveness of treatments.
- ** Implant Prosthetics **: With 3D printing, oral cosmetic surgeons can develop customized implant prosthetics that completely fit a person's distinct composition, leading to better results and client satisfaction.
- ** Bone Grafting **: 3D printing allows the production of patient-specific bone grafts, lowering the requirement for typical grafting methods and improving recovery and healing time.
- ** Education and learning and Educating **: 3D printing can be made use of to create realistic medical models for academic functions, enabling oral surgeons to exercise intricate treatments prior to doing them on individuals.
With its potential to improve precision, modification, and training, 3D printing is an amazing development in the field of oral surgery.
Minimally Invasive Methods
To further advance the field of dental surgery, welcome the possibility of minimally intrusive techniques that can considerably profit both surgeons and people alike.
Minimally invasive methods are reinventing the area by decreasing surgical injury, reducing post-operative discomfort, and speeding up the healing procedure. These techniques involve using smaller sized cuts and specialized instruments to execute treatments with precision and performance.

In addition, using lasers in dental surgery enables precise tissue cutting and coagulation, resulting in reduced blood loss and minimized recovery time.
With minimally invasive strategies, people can experience much faster recovery, reduced scarring, and enhanced results, making it a crucial element of the future of oral surgery.
